Cats spend most of their time curled up and asleep. If you or your partner is fed up with your cat sleeping in your bed or on your couch and leaving fur everywhere or you want to give your cats a space of their own, a cat bed is your best option. Also, unless they are very young kittens, each cat needs a bed of its own. Before you purchase a bed for your cat, there are things that you should consider.

Size - Knowing the size of your cat is an important consideration. Cats need a little room to stretch and be comfortable. However, if the cat bed is too big your cat may feel less secure. Simply measure your cat from head to tail and add a few inches to insure a snuggly fit for your kitty.

Comfort There are tons of fantastic options for you to choose from. They come in different forms, structures and materials. The most popular shapes are round or tubular tumble beds. Cat beds that have a fleece, sherpa or thermal cushion material will keep your cat warm and comfortable especially during winter.

Durability- Make sure that your cat bed is made of durable materials to prevent it from being easily scratched or torn. Choose ones that are washable or at least have a removable and washable cover. You do not want your kitty to sleep in a smelly bed. Like you, cats enjoy a clean bed. A clean cat bed will also help prevent parasites, allergens and odors.
